  • Abstract
    As a very important technique in biometric recognition, face recognition has many applications in our daily life. It is a very complex problem influenced by the different light condition, pose, head angles, and so on. 108 face images of 27 subjects in ORL face database are efficiently recognized with the developmental network. To testify the effect of developmental network on the face recognition, the influences of different initializing methods for the weights from X layer to Y layer of the DN, and different neuron numbers and competing neuron number top-k in Y layer, are studied. Experimental results show that when the neuron number in Y layer is bigger than the number of subjects to be recognized, the recognition accuracy can reach over 95%. Otherwise, the recognition accuracy decreases significantly. Under the condition of the same neuron numbers in Y layer, with the increasing of fired neuron number k, the recognition accuracy decreases.
